∛1 — is the symbolic representation of ‘cube root of 1’.
∛1=1
∛1 has three roots→ 1,𝛚, 𝛚2, which on multiplication together gives “1” as a product. 1×𝛚×𝛚2=1.
As mentioned above, the cube root of 1 or the cube root of unity are 1,𝛚, 𝛚2, where 1 is a real root, 𝛚 and 𝛚2 are the imaginary roots.
The essential features or properties of the cube root of 1 are:
The imaginary roots 𝛚 and 𝛚2 when multiplied together, yields 1
𝛚×𝛚2= 𝛚3=1
The summation of the roots is zero → 1+𝛚+𝛚2=0.
The imaginary root 𝛚, when squared, is expressed as 𝛚2, which is equal to another imaginary root.
Now, let us find the meaning of 𝛚 here. To find the cube root of 1, we will make use of some algebraic formulas. We know that, the cube root of 1 is represented as ∛1. Let us assume that ∛1= a, so,
∛1= a
⇒ 1 = a3
⇒ a3- 1 = 0
⇒ (a - 1)(a2+a+1) = 0 [using a3-b3= (a - b)(a2+a.b+b2)]
⇒ a - 1 =0
⇒ a= 1 …………..(1)
Again, a2+a+1 = 0
⇒ a = (-1 ±√(12–4×1×1)) / 2×1
⇒ a = (-1 ±√(–3)) / 2
⇒ a = (-1 ± i√3) / 2
⇒ a = (-1 + i√3) / 2 …………(2)
Or
a = (-1 - i√3) / 2 …………(3)
From equation (1), (2), and (3), we get,
The roots are → 1, (-1 + i√3) / 2 and (-1 - i√3) / 2
